When Alignment Isn't Enough: Response-Path Attacks on LLM Agents

This paper introduces the Relay Tampering Attack (RTA), demonstrating that malicious third-party relays can undermine the security of LLM agents by modifying responses post-alignment, even if the LLM itself is perfectly aligned.

MyoSem: Aligning Electromyography to Natural-Language Action Semantics for Hand Action Understanding

MyoSem introduces an EMG-action semantic alignment framework that transforms low-level muscle signals into a shared semantic space, enabling bidirectional retrieval between EMG data and natural language action descriptions.

VLBM: Variational Latent Basis Modeling for OOD Robust Multivariate Time Series Forecasting

The paper proposes VLBM, a latent basis modeling framework, to achieve state-of-the-art robustness in multivariate time series forecasting, particularly when facing rare but high-impact out-of-distribution (OOD) events.
